emacs-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Your last change to browse-url is bogus.


From: Johannes Weiner
Subject: Re: Your last change to browse-url is bogus.
Date: Wed, 12 Sep 2007 12:20:39 +0200
User-agent: Mutt/1.5.16 (2007-06-11)

Hi Micha,

On Wed, Sep 12, 2007 at 11:13:42AM +0200, Michaël Cadilhac wrote:
> I'd suggest to revert this change or, if it's for the sake of code
> factoring, (what was the first purpose, by the way?)

Yes, code factoring.

> use something like this:

> --- browse-url.el     12 Sep 2007 10:49:04 +0200      1.61
> +++ browse-url.el     12 Sep 2007 11:09:27 +0200      
[...]
> -  (setq file (browse-url-encode-url file))
> +  (setq file (browse-url-encode-url file "[*\"()',=;? ]" 'encode-percent))
[...]
> -  (setq url (browse-url-encode-url url))
> +  (setq url (browse-url-encode-url url "[,)$]"))
[...]
> -  (setq url (browse-url-encode-url url))
> +  (setq url (browse-url-encode-url url "[,)$]"))
[...]
> -  (setq url (browse-url-encode-url url))
> +  (setq url (browse-url-encode-url url "[,)$]"))
[...]
> -  (setq url (browse-url-encode-url url))
> +  (setq url (browse-url-encode-url url "[,)$]"))
[...]
> -  (setq url (browse-url-encode-url url))
> +  (setq url (browse-url-encode-url url "[,)$]"))
[...]
> -  (setq url (browse-url-encode-url url))
> +  (setq url (browse-url-encode-url url "[,)$]"))

These use mostly the same argument.  Can't we generalize this?  Would it hurt
the callsites if they all would use "[*\"()',=;? ]"?

        Hannes

Attachment: signature.asc
Description: Digital signature


reply via email to

[Prev in Thread] Current Thread [Next in Thread]